These driving mats are versatile in that they can be used anywhere, inside or outside and taken with the person to different locations. These mats do not require tools to set up and are light enough to be carried around by the golfer, making them very convenient to use. Most can simply be rolled out like a carpet. Some popular places to use these driving mats are at parks and in a persons own backyard. Some indoor practice ranges even require them because of limited space or availability.

Golf is an old sport. It was played in a primitive form in Scotland way back in 1432. It is known that King James IV in 1491 decreed that playing of golf be cut down as it led to the neglect of archery- vital in the warfare of the times. Golf's roots can be traced back to the game of "Pagamia" of the Roman period that was played with a feather stuffed ball and bent sticks.
